Passenger bus vandalized in Mahottari

By No Author
GAUSHALA, April 7: Cadres of 30-party alliance have vandalized a passenger-ferrying bus at Mahottari district headquarters, Jaleswor, this morning.

A group of shutdown enforcers comprising hundreds in number broke down a Muna Deluxe Bus (Ja 1 Kha 659) at Jaleswor municipality chowk for allegedly defying general strike.


They vandalized the bus ferrying passengers from Samsi of Mahottari district. The shutdown has gripped normal life in Mahottari since early this morning as no vehicles are seen plying on the road.

Meanwhile, the alliance leaders and cadres have descended to streets enforcing closure of local groceries, market, factories and industries in Bardibas, Gaushala, Matihani, Samsi and Pipara including Jaleswor of the district. RSS
